Fruit Galore Sponge Cake

If you have some fruit you want to use up, and you don't have all that much time, this recipe is perfect! Especially on a summer day, this is a great dessert after a BBQ. Yumm Yumm! Any combination of fruit works in this versatile treat
Ingredients
1/3 cup vanilla flavored syrup
1 sponge cake
1 cup blueberries
1 cup sliced strawberries
1 (12 ounce) container frozen whipped topping, thawed
Instructions
Drizzle vanilla syrup over top of sponge cake. Let soak for 5 to 10 minutes.
Arrange blueberries on top of cake, then place strawberries on top of the blueberries. Finish by generously spreading whipped topping over the fruit.
Serve immediately, or if you prefer, chill in the refrigerator (no more than 2 to 3 hours), until ready to eat.
